Output 20eaecf53fb90803a953527dc154f072aff2d24a2781eeaaafcf87428a599769:6

value
34780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82d1407f0797406c6f4cbc7bb2bf594dcc7ebfd1 OP_EQUAL
address
3DciSZWN9zwscQpD6TdAaA7zaRHrkiksnR
transaction
20eaecf53fb90803a953527dc154f072aff2d24a2781eeaaafcf87428a599769
confirmations
496415
spent
true